Жеребьевка командного круговика
Добавлено: 11 июн 2022, 22:37
Делюсь рецептом командного круговика, вдруг кому пригодится. Мы время от времени такой проводим между двумя городами, и я всем рекомендую попробовать, отличная штука.
1. Сохраните код в файле с названием Krugovik.java, например в Notepad (можно заменить буквы с цифрами на фамилии игроков)
2. Зайдите в папку с файлом, зажмите клавишу Shift и щелкните правой кнопкой мыши.
3. Выберите в меню "Открыть окно команд" (Open PowerShell window here)
4. В появившемся окне напечатайте:
javac Krugovik.java (ввод)
java Krugovik (ввод)
5. (по желанию) Внесите жеребьевку в Го-Рефери, добавьте фору по вкусу
Код:
public class Krugovik {
public static void main(String[] args) {
String Team_A [] = {"a1", "a2", "a3", "a4", "a5"};
String Team_B [] = {"b1", "b2", "b3", "b4", "b5"};
int i = 0, l = Team_A.length;
for (int n = 0; n < l; n++){
System.out.print("Game " + (n+1) + " ");
for ( i = 0; i < l; i++){
System.out.print(Team_A[i] + "-" + Team_B[(i+n)%l] + " ");
}
System.out.print("\n");
}
}
}
1. Сохраните код в файле с названием Krugovik.java, например в Notepad (можно заменить буквы с цифрами на фамилии игроков)
2. Зайдите в папку с файлом, зажмите клавишу Shift и щелкните правой кнопкой мыши.
3. Выберите в меню "Открыть окно команд" (Open PowerShell window here)
4. В появившемся окне напечатайте:
javac Krugovik.java (ввод)
java Krugovik (ввод)
5. (по желанию) Внесите жеребьевку в Го-Рефери, добавьте фору по вкусу
Код:
public class Krugovik {
public static void main(String[] args) {
String Team_A [] = {"a1", "a2", "a3", "a4", "a5"};
String Team_B [] = {"b1", "b2", "b3", "b4", "b5"};
int i = 0, l = Team_A.length;
for (int n = 0; n < l; n++){
System.out.print("Game " + (n+1) + " ");
for ( i = 0; i < l; i++){
System.out.print(Team_A[i] + "-" + Team_B[(i+n)%l] + " ");
}
System.out.print("\n");
}
}
}